Analysis
Madagascar recorded 1.26 for co2 emissions by sector (mt co2 eq) - electricity/heat in 2018.
That represents a change of down 11.3% on the previous year and up 200.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, co2 emissions by sector (mt co2 eq) - electricity/heat in Madagascar peaked at 1.42 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 0.12, in 1996.
Madagascar ranks 120th of 186 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 0.207 | 0.12 | 0.28 | 10 |
| 2000s | 0.362 | 0.28 | 0.42 | 10 |
| 2010s | 1.06 | 0.45 | 1.42 | 9 |
